Question

if two lines are perpendicular, then the lines intersect to form four right angles that are 180? each.
true
false

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

First, recall the definition of perpendicular lines: two lines are perpendicular if they intersect at a right angle (90°). When two perpendicular lines intersect, they form four angles, each of which is 90° (a right angle), not 180°. So the statement has an error in the angle measure (saying right angles are 180° each, which is incorrect as right angles are 90°). Thus, the statement is false.

Answer:

False
